WebUsing NDS, NASA developed the International Docking Adapter (IDA) to provide two IDSS-compliant docking ports on the ISS. The IDAs were delivered to the ISS starting in 2016. Each of two existing Pressurized Mating Adapters has an IDA permanently attached, so the former PMA function is no longer available for visiting spacecraft.

Web25. jún 2024 · The initial Shuttle-Mir agreement called for a flight of a Russian cosmonaut aboard a space shuttle, a long-duration flight of an American astronaut aboard Mir, and the docking of a space shuttle with Mir. Cosmonaut Sergey K. Krikalev fulfilled the first goal when he flew as a crew member aboard STS-60 in February 1994.
